Optimize Shapes
Use the Design Variable options to automatically generate optimization variables. These variables can then be used to optimize the surface of the part with respect to the given shapes.
-
From the Morph ribbon, click the Shapes tool.
Figure 1.
The Edit Shapes dialog opens. - Select one or more shapes.
-
For Design Variable, select the type of variables you want to create.
- Off
- No design variable is created for the selected shapes. This is the default option.
- Desvar
- This option automatically creates DESVAR design variable cards.
- Design Explorer
- This option automatically creates Design Variable parameter cards.
-
Define the Lower, Initial, and Upper Bound values.
By default, these values are -1.0, 0, and 1.0 respectively. Where -1.0 means the shape will be moved to 100% of its nodal perturbation in the negative direction. Where 1.0 means a 100% perturbation in the positive direction. These values act as a scaling factor of the shape. With 0 representing the initial unmorphed state.
- Click OK.
